Shara Nelson and ‘Go That Deep’ bring NUfrequency back into the spotlight
26 March, 2008 | 2.39PM- Section: Music News Topics: House Nation
It’s been almost three years since NUfrequency debuted with the Essential New Tune ‘808 (Why Oh Why)’.
The Italian collaboration between DJ Shield, Alessandro Ripamonti and Christiano Massera crafted an irritably catchy instrumental that was hauntingly beautiful and simple in equal parts.
Fast forward to present day, and they return with their sophomore release joined by one of greatest British soul voices of our era, Shara Nelson.
‘Go That Deep’ on Rebirth has been a slow burner for a few months since copies were leaked to the fortune few.
As with their debut, this is another textbook blend of electronica seamlessly matched with lush orchestrated arrangements akin to those of Air.
Yet whilst comparisons can be flattering, they can also mask true creativeness that NUfrequency clearly possess.
It’s the voice that truly makes this a special moment — Shara’s delivery is faultless and hauntingly surreal with Charles Webster’s moody deep house mix in particular the perfect platform, while Redanka offer one of their best mixes since they rocked U2’s ‘Vertigo’.
An early contender for record of the year.
